在Python中,可以使用sum()
函數來求和。sum()
函數可以接受一個可迭代對象作為參數,并返回該可迭代對象中所有元素的和。
下面是一些使用sum()
函數求和的例子:
sum()
函數求解列表的和:numbers = [1, 2, 3, 4, 5]
total = sum(numbers)
print(total) # 輸出15,即1 + 2 + 3 + 4 + 5的和
sum()
函數求解元組的和:numbers = (1, 2, 3, 4, 5)
total = sum(numbers)
print(total) # 輸出15,即1 + 2 + 3 + 4 + 5的和
sum()
函數求解集合的和:numbers = {1, 2, 3, 4, 5}
total = sum(numbers)
print(total) # 輸出15,即1 + 2 + 3 + 4 + 5的和
sum()
函數求解字典的和(求解字典的和是求解字典中所有鍵對應的值的和):numbers = {"a": 1, "b": 2, "c": 3, "d": 4, "e": 5}
total = sum(numbers.values())
print(total) # 輸出15,即1 + 2 + 3 + 4 + 5的和
需要注意的是,sum()
函數只能用于數字類型的可迭代對象,如果可迭代對象中包含非數字類型的元素,將會拋出TypeError
。